Volunteer with Friends of the Wissahickon at Andorra Natural Area

November is Planting Month at the Friends of the Wissahickon. Join FOW at the Andorra Natural Area on Saturday, November 9, 2013, from 9 am - 1 pm. Volunteers will plant the final closure of the Andorra Natural Area trail system. Approximately 100 trees and shrubs will be planted before the weather becomes too cold.

About Friends of the Wissahickon

The Friends of the Wissahickon, founded in 1924, is a non-profit organization dedicated to preserving the Wissahickon Valley. FOW works in partnership with Philadelphia Parks and Recreation to restore historical structures throughout the park, eliminate invasive plant species, monitor watershed management issues, and restore trails throughout the Wissahickon Valley Park with its Sustainable Trails Initiative.
